Thomas M. Markovich, 54 passed away peacefully Tuesday Sept 29 at St. Elizabeth Medical Center in Youngstown. Thomas was born January 4, 1966 in Youngstown, a son of Thomas J. and Peggy Yankulak Markovich. He was a 1984 graduate of Woodrow Wilson High School and was a project manager for Valley Electric Consolidated. He was a member of St. Peter and Paul Church and enjoyed camping at Western Reserve Campgrounds and jet skiing on Lake Erie. Along with his mother, Thomas leaves to cherish his memory his Brother John (Jackie) Markovich, nephews Patrick and Daniel, niece Lauren, and his golden retrievers Lacy and Tess. He is preceded in death by his father Thomas J. Markovich who passed February 2, 2016.
